Judge Salas presided over a wide range of cases. Last week, she was assigned to oversee a class-action lawsuit filed by a group of investors against Deutsche Bank, contending that the firm failed to flag questionable transactions that were made from the account of the financier Jeffrey Epstein, who died last August while in jail awaiting trial on sex-trafficking charges. Nominated by Barack Obama on January 5, 2011, to a seat vacated by Katharine Sweeney Hayden. Confirmed by the Senate on June 14, 2011, and received commission on June 14, 2011. Law clerk, Hon. Eugene J. Codey, Jr., Superior Court of New Jersey, 1994-1995 Private practice, Plainfield, New Jersey, 1995-1997 Assistant federal public defender, District of New Jersey, 1997-2006U.S. Magistrate Judge, U.S. District Court for the District of New Jersey, 2006-2011 Rutgers University, B.A., 1991 Rutgers School of Law -- Newark, J.D., 1994
